#0aff16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0aff16 is composed of 3.9% red, 100%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.4%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 122.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 52%. #0aff16 color hex could be obtained by blending #14ff2c with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

● #0aff16 color description : Vivid lime green.
#0aff16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0aff16 has RGB values of R:10, G:255,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0. Its decimal value is 720662.

Shades and Tints of #0aff16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a00 is the darkest color, while #f5f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0aff16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8e7c is the less saturated color, while #0aff16 is the most saturated one.
